What to look for in a lap desk
When searching for a lap desk, it's most important to first think about what features are most important to you. Here are some features to keep in mind:
Phone mounts: If you like to have your phone nearby or need multiple screens to work, a phone mount is ideal. If your phone only distracts you, a mount may not be necessary.
Device ledges: One of the most important features of a lap desk, a device ledge keeps your computer from falling off.
Storage space: To help keep your work area organized, storage space can be very helpful.
Leg cushions: Almost all lap desks have leg cushions. Look for ones with dual bolsters that will provide some airflow.
Adjustability: An adjustable lap desk can provide more flexibility in where you work, and it could improve your posture while working.
Lap desk FAQs
Are lap desks good for you?
Dr. Sforzo explained that a lap desk can help elevate your work surface, which can improve your posture. However, he cautioned against solely relying on a lap desk because it's not a proper ergonomic setup. "If you spend a lot of time working at a desk, investing in a comfortable chair and a desk that is the appropriate height for you is important. Additionally, taking breaks to stretch and move around can help prevent discomfort and injury," he explained.
If you're going to spend any amount of time working from your bed, couch, or bean bag chair, though, a quality lap desk can certainly elevate your experience.
Why use a lap desk?
If you want to work from the couch or bed, a lap desk can make things easier and more comfortable. According to Thebado, "When people come to Staples looking for a lap desk the big thing they are looking for is an ergonomic solution, simply put, they want to be comfortable when working from the couch, or even their bed."
"A lap desk also aids in avoiding direct contact with your body," Thebado noted, as laptops are prone to overheating when on soft surfaces, and the temperatures can be uncomfortable.

Amazon Warns AI Capacity Limits, Stock Retreats
Amazon (NASDAQ:AMZN) slid after its earnings call because Andy Jassy was blunt: AI demand is real, but the company can't just snap its fingers and supply enough capacity. Electricity and chip shortages are the choke points, and he said it will take several quarters to work through it, even if things slowly improve each period. Warning! GuruFocus has detected 5 Warning Signs with NVDA. He pushed back on the idea Amazon is losing the AI race and leaned into the spend$31.4Billion of AI-heavy capex in Q2 is the kind of run rate the back half is built on, with more going into chips, data centers and power. Tariffs haven't bitten yet in H1, he said, but who ends up paying higher U.S. rates later is still unclear. That caution rubbed some investors the wrong way. Lucas Ma of Envision Research warned the heavy investment and mounting competition from GOOG (NASDAQ:GOOG) and META (NASDAQ:META) could squeeze free cash flow, making capital allocation riskier if the AI arms race keeps accelerating. Amazon is chasing a big AI opportunity while bumping up against real limits, so growth hinges on execution and capital discipline. The next signs to watch are whether capacity actually ramps as promised and whether margin or cash flow pressure shows up once tariffs shift. This article first appeared on GuruFocus.
